Once more. Here is the code with OR and without continuity correction: library(metafor) dat2007 <- dat.nielweise2007 library(meta) m1 <- metabin(ai, n1i, ci, n2i, sm = "OR", incr = 0, data = dat2007) m2 <- metabin(ai, n1i, ci, n2i, sm = "OR", incr = 0, data=dat2007[dat2007$ai==0,]) m1 m2 For m2, with only zero events, you obtain OR = 0, but without estimates for the standard error and thus without confidence intervals. Dear metafor community, I am a Stata user with only limited knowledge of R. I am trying to validate some Stata code by comparing with output from metafor; in particular, sparse data/zero cells using Mantel-Haenszel methods. My reference is Wolfgang's page "http://www.metafor-project.org/doku.php/tips:comp_mh_different_software". If I type: library(metafor) dat <- dat.nielweise2007 rma.mh(measure="OR", ai=ai, n1i=n1i, ci=ci, n2i=n2i, data=dat) ...then I successfully obtain the output shown on the webpage. However, if I alter the command in (seemingly) any way, I get the following error: Error in sprintf(format, names(x)) : invalid format '%NA'; use format %s for character objects For instance, if I limit the dataset to studies with zero events in the treatment arm: rma.mh(measure="OR", ai=ai, n1i=n1i, ci=ci, n2i=n2i, data=dat2007[which(dat2007$ai==0),]) ...and similarly if I attempt to use another data frame, or import from Stata using "read.dta". Furthermore, I do not appear to have the same issue if I use another model. For instance, the following runs with no problem: rma(measure="OR", ai=ai, n1i=n1i, ci=ci, n2i=n2i, data=dat2007[which(dat2007$ai==0),]) I am using a fresh install of R 4.0.1 and of the metafor package. Could someone point me in the right direction? Many thanks, David.
